Florida City man arrested in shooting, killing of cousin

Charlie Holley, 33, denied bond

FLORIDA CITY, Fla. ā€“ A man from Florida City is facing multiple charges in the fatal shooting of his cousin.

Charlie Holley, 33, appeared in bond court Monday where he was denied bond for a second-degree murder charge.

According to police, Holley left his cousin's home on Northwest 12 Street and 9 Court on July 12 after having an argument with her. He then returned to the home with a gun and banged on the front door to be let inside.

Another cousin, who is eight months pregnant, said she went outside to talk to Holley and he slapped her in the face and then pistol-whipped her.

She said he screamed, "I'll shoot you and your kids. I'll shoot everybody in there."

She said the other cousin then came outside and told her to go inside for the safety of her unborn child.

According to the arrest report, Holley walked down the street before turning and shooting his cousin in her abdominal area.

She was taken to the hospital where she was pronounced dead.
